Coronation Street’s Millie is set to target Todd with some manipulative behaviour.
Millie’s father Theo has been dating Todd, but the couple have had their share of problems recently.
Earlier this month, Millie turned up at the door of the Grimshaws to reveal she is pregnant, leading to more problems between Theo and Todd as his daughter begins to take up more of his attention.
Most recently, Todd put Theo’s phone on airplane mode on a night out, meaning the father missed a call from Danielle telling him that his pregnant daughter was in hospital.
Millie has also confided in Theo that she isn’t happy living with her mum, leading him to suggest she should stay at number 11 for a while longer.

ITV
Meanwhile, Todd has recently struck up a friendship with newly single James Bailey, after the pair enjoyed a drink in the Rovers Return together following a squabble between Todd and Theo.
The pairs’ chemistry was instantly noticed by viewers, with some even suggesting Todd should dump Theo for James.
Later this month Theo will become jealous of James after he tells Todd he’s set himself up as a personal trainer.

ITV
Seeing her father’s jealousy, Millie forms a plan and tells Todd that she’s booked him a training session with James to say sorry for her recent behaviour.
But will Todd realise Millie is setting him up?
Later in the week Todd spots Millie with a can of lager and berates her for drinking whilst pregnant.
When Millie begs him not to tell Theo, will Todd comply?
